From 3ec721b9c2a382185b76ebadef317c85e85d9558 Mon Sep 17 00:00:00 2001 From: nobu Date: Sun, 10 Oct 2010 01:20:11 +0000 Subject: [PATCH] * configure.in (RUBY_MINGW32): canonicalize as like mswin version. git-svn-id: svn+ssh://ci.ruby-lang.org/ruby/trunk@29433 b2dd03c8-39d4-4d8f-98ff-823fe69b080e --- ChangeLog | 4 ++++ configure.in | 12 +++++++++--- 2 files changed, 13 insertions(+), 3 deletions(-) diff --git a/ChangeLog b/ChangeLog index 9cbe32d65a..ebd9702222 100644 --- a/ChangeLog +++ b/ChangeLog @@ -1,3 +1,7 @@ +Sun Oct 10 10:20:07 2010 Nobuyoshi Nakada + + * configure.in (RUBY_MINGW32): canonicalize as like mswin version. + Sun Oct 10 05:33:14 2010 Nobuyoshi Nakada * vm_core.h (rb_signal_buff_size, rb_signal_exec): moved diff --git a/configure.in b/configure.in index 158a7e65d1..4e9f253847 100644 --- a/configure.in +++ b/configure.in @@ -34,10 +34,16 @@ AC_CACHE_CHECK(for mingw32 environment, rb_cv_mingw32, ], rb_cv_mingw32=yes,rb_cv_mingw32=no) rm -f conftest*]) test "$rb_cv_mingw32" = yes && target_os="mingw32" - ]) +]) AS_CASE(["$target_os"], [mingw*msvc], [ target_os="`echo ${target_os} | sed 's/msvc$//'`" - ])]) +]) +AS_CASE(["$target_cpu"], [x86_64], [ +# canonicalize as like mswin version. see win32/setup.mak. +target_cpu=x64 +target_os="`echo ${target_os} | sed 's/32$/64/'`" +]) +]) AC_DEFUN([RUBY_CPPOUTFILE], [AC_CACHE_CHECK(whether ${CPP} accepts -o, rb_cv_cppoutfile, @@ -1561,7 +1567,7 @@ fi AC_DEFUN(RUBY_STACK_GROW_DIRECTION, [ AC_CACHE_CHECK(stack growing direction on $1, rb_cv_stack_grow_dir_$1, [ AS_CASE(["$1"], -[m68*|x86*|i?86|ia64|ppc*|sparc*|alpha*], [ $2=-1], +[m68*|x86*|x64|i?86|ia64|ppc*|sparc*|alpha*], [ $2=-1], [hppa*], [ $2=+1], [ AC_TRY_RUN([